Continuous CGT Planning
Published on 24 May 02 by WESTERN AUSTRALIAN DIVISION, THE TAX INSTITUTE
Capital Gains Tax continues to be a difficult arena for tax professionals, notwithstanding it generally dates back to 1985. CGT however has a tax planning timeframe which can embrace many years, even a lifetime.
Chris Evans is a nationally acclaimed presenter on all CGT matters and takes us through
- a comprehensive analysis of CGT foundations
- a five step approach to CGT
- practical CGT planning techniques
- pitfalls to consider in CGT planning
- Capital Gains ax planning for life
